2008 Indo-Pakistani standoff
After the 2008 Mumbai attacks, Pakistan and the ISI were believed by India to be directly responsible behind the attacks, leading to strained relations between the two countries for a period of time. An anti-Pakistan sentiment also rose in India, causing many, including even the United States to call for probes into it.
